Why do Wolves only have 3 cubs?

Gray wolves can have anywhere from 1 to 14 pups in a single litter, but the average size is about 4 to 6 pups. The number of pups vary due to the number of eggs that become fertilised in the womb.

How many babies can gray seals have?

Grey seals usually only have 1 to 2 babies at a time. On the east coast grey seals have their pups in the autumn. On the west coast these seals have their pups in the winter. The pups only stay with their mother for the first month of their life and then venture off on their own.

How does the omega wolf breed?

The omega doesn't breed. Only the alpha pair breeds. If other pups are born in the pack that are not the alpha's, they can either be accepted, or are killed/abandoned to give the alpha's pups a better chance to survive.
